## Changelog — Font vendoring defaults changed

As of this release, the Bracken UI build no longer fetches third-party fonts at build time. All typefaces used by the Lanternwell suite are now vendored into the repo under a dedicated assets directory, and the fetch step is skipped by default. If you're onboarding, nothing to install — the fonts travel with the checkout. The build flags controlling this behavior are listed below.

settings of hadup-yafog:
LAMAEL_PIN=3761
LAMAEL_TENANT=istmir
LAMAEL_METRICS_HOST=metrics.lamael.plorvasys.test
LAMAEL_SEAL=seal_8ea68500
LAMAEL_STANDBY_TEAM=fraok

MEMO — To: Department Heads, Varnisse Group. Subject: FY Training Budget. Next year's training allocation is set at 1.8% of departmental payroll, down from 2.1%. Priority goes to compliance certifications and the Ledgerline systems migration. External conference attendance requires director approval. Unused funds will not roll over. Submit draft training plans to the People Office by end of month. The confidential planning context directly below explains the reduction and is restricted to this distribution.

confidential, kagep-kahof: Druokax Systems plans to lower the Ulaath list price by 53 percent in March.

TURN-208: Gatevale turnstile counters at the Merrow Field pilot double-count when a rotation reverses mid-cycle. Attendance totals drift roughly 2% high per event. The debounce window fix is implemented, reviewed by Ilsa, and soak-tested across two simulated match days without drift. Ready for your cut; the candidate build is identified below.

trace token, tagag-tafog: htk6_5ed18c

# Limits and Quotas — Proselint-9 Documentation Linter

The Proselint-9 linter enforces hard limits to keep CI runs bounded. Files above the size cap are skipped with a warning, not failed, so large generated docs do not block merges. Rule evaluation has a per-file time budget; exceeding it aborts that rule only. Quotas apply per pipeline, not per author. New team members should review these before adjusting pipelines. The governing constants are listed below.

tuning constants:
QUOTAS = {
    "druwyn": 5,
    "holix": 5,
    "zorath": 5,
    "holwyn": 10,
}